Word origin

From Latin persona ('mask, character, person'), originally an actor's mask. The English 'person' and 'persona' derive from the same source.

est à la fois un nom féminin (a person) et un pronom négatif (nobody, no one) qui requiert ne dans la proposition : personne ne sait (nobody knows). Le pronom personne est toujours grammaticalement masculin singulier même si le nom est féminin.

La grande personne (an adult, a grown-up) est l'expression utilisée avec les enfants. En personne (in person, personally) s'oppose à une représentation ou à une communication à distance. Quelqu'un est l'antonyme positif de personne en tant que pronom indéfini.
